## Onboarding: Shrinkwright CLI

Shrinkwright is our internal CLI for batch image resizing across the Mossvale asset pipeline. Reviewers should note that all invocations are logged, output buckets are write-once, and the signing keystore is sealed between releases. To unseal the keystore for an audited inspection session, enter the passphrase below.

recovery phrase for fawif-tajeg: norael-aldmir-casir-brivan-ulaion

# Deep-link routing config for the Wayfern mobile apps. Release manager:
# these values control how universal links resolve to in-app screens, and a
# mismatch between environments will silently drop users on the web fallback.
# Verify the route map version matches the app build you are shipping before
# promoting. The link-verification signing secret must appear on the next line.

sealed setting: VAULT_KEY20=c8ea1e419912889df6b4

## Formula sandbox tuning

User-supplied formulas in Gridmoor execute inside a restricted interpreter with hard ceilings on time, memory, and call depth. Reviewers should confirm any change to these ceilings is justified in the PR description, since raising them widens the abuse surface. Defaults were chosen from production traces. The current limits are as follows.

limits module of tafog-fawip:
WEIGHTS = {
    "julix": 57,
    "lamys": 992,
    "kasvan": 209,
    "quenok": 750,
    "alddor": 259,
    "oliath": 1009,
    "wenix": 815,
}